      @@rayray9865 the celebration of DDLM is a public celebration. It is not a solemn day. Although people can get emotional during this time, it's not closed. It is and always has been open to the public. Since the aztect who literally decorated the levels of the pyramids for strangers to come and look. This is why there are ofrendas in the street and cemeteries are open. I grew up visiting the cemeteries in Mexico where my family are from. People line the inside and outside waiting to see how beautiful it looks. Mariachi play and people drink openly.... in the cemetary. It's literally a huge party. So yeah, if someone is having a hard time, it's probably going to be noticed. Even then, the people standing by will offer a hug and talk. This is what I meant about her taking pictures or video clips. Taking pictures of the celebration is original in Mexico ever since they were able to share their culture that way. Non indigenous people are more than welcome to adopt the culture as well.

      @@lifewithvicx I have a question, the free alcohol pulque was sweet? 🤔And I have another question, it wasn't slimy? Maybe I'm wrong, but if it wasn't slimy and it was sweet, probably what you drank was "aguamiel de agave", Technically it is not pulque, but they sell it as alcohol-free pulque, something like alcohol-free beer, that means is the liquid that usually is fermented but before being fermented.
